The primary purpose of this position is: To provide professional library and information services, analyze collection development, management, and efficiency, and to serve as a supervisor.
Responsible for a collection of over 600,000 print and digital items worth over $1B. Provides expert input regarding the development and implementation of procedures for the collection, processing, storage, and dissemination of library materials. periodicals, interlibrary loan, and SNCOA branch activities, to result in an integrated reference service. Directly supervises two GS-1410-11 Librarians, one GS-1411-07 Supervisory Library Technician, and one GS-1411- 05 Library Technician. Direct all Collections Services Branch Management and Operational Activities. Provide effective and efficient management of Collections Services Branch areas, including between Circulation, Document Vault Services, and Archives and Special Collections. Responsible for allocation and approval of all budget items for library collections program. Establishes management controls (milestones, expenditure rates, management indicators, management reviews, etc.), monitors program status, provides early indications of emerging problems, takes appropriate actions to approve terms and conditions set forth in negotiations, contracting plans, budgets, subcontractor participation, and addition or discontinuance of work by the contractor.
